About Fei Yan
Fei Yan is a scholar working on Mechanical Engineering, Mechanics of Materials, Civil and Structural Engineering, Computational Mechanics and Materials Chemistry, having authored 140 papers that have together received 2.5k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Welding Techniques and Residual Stresses (34 papers), Numerical methods in engineering (29 papers), Advanced Welding Techniques Analysis (26 papers), Rock Mechanics and Modeling (21 papers), Geotechnical Engineering and Underground Structures (13 papers), Advanced Numerical Methods in Computational Mathematics (12 papers), Additive Manufacturing Materials and Processes (12 papers) and Aluminum Alloy Microstructure Properties (11 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Mechanics of Materials (1.2k citations), Metals and Alloys (86 citations), Mechanical Engineering (1.2k citations), Civil and Structural Engineering (633 citations) and Management, Monitoring, Policy and Law (294 citations). Fei Yan has collaborated with scholars based in China, United States and Taiwan. Frequent co-authors include Xia‐Ting Feng, Peng‐Zhi Pan, Chunming Wang, Quan Jiang, Xiyuan Hu, Shaojun Li, Dingping Xu, Kaiwen Xia, Fang Chai and Zhenhua Wu. Their work appears in journals such as Engineering Analysis with Boundary Elements, Optics & Laser Technology, Materials Characterization, Rock Mechanics and Rock Engineering and The International Journal of Advanced Manufacturing Technology.
